KVK WINS BEST KRISHI VIGYAN KENDRA AWARD

Read in:English

Raj Sadosh/Abohar.

Krishi Vigyan Kendra (KVK), working under the ICAR-Central Institute of Post-Harvest Engineering Technology, Abohar has been conferred with the “Best Krishi Vigyan Kendra Award 2025 Punjab”.

The award, presented at Annual Zonal Workshop, honors KVK's dedication under the leadership of Director, CIPHET, Dr. Nachiket Kotwaliwale and guidance of Head, RS, Abohar Dr Amit Nath in recognition of its outstanding contributions to agricultural extension and farmer-centric development.

The award was presented to Dr Arvind Ahlawat, Head, KVK, during the Annual Zonal Workshop of Krishi Vigyan Kendras organized at SKUAST-Jammu under the aegis of ICAR–Agricultural Technology Application Research Institute (ATARI).

Dr Kotwaliwale appreciated the consistent efforts of KVK in effectively translating agricultural research into field-level applications. He highlighted the Kendra’s notable work in crop residue management, value addition, and promotion of sustainable agricultural practices.

Dr Ahlawat expressed his gratitude to ICAR-ATARI and stated that the recognition is the result of collective efforts of the scientists and staff of the KVK, along with the active participation of progressive farmers of the district. He added that the award would further encourage the KVK to strengthen farmer-oriented extension activities and adopt need-based, technology-driven interventions
